Grade B, and why
aigent-builder scanned grade B with 1 finding against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 2d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Enumerates other installed skillsmediumAgent snooping
Other skills' SKILL.md files reveal prompts, capabilities and secrets that should be invisible to peers.

Skill Builder
Setup
Check if aigent is available:
command -v aigent
With aigent CLI
If aigent is on $PATH, use the CLI for authoritative skill generation:
-
Build the skill:
aigent new "<purpose>" --dir .claude/skills/<name>/ -
Validate the result:
aigent validate .claude/skills/<name>/ -
If validation reports errors, fix the SKILL.md and re-validate.
Use --no-llm to force deterministic mode (no API keys needed).
Use --name <name> to override the derived skill name.
The CLI defaults to outputting in ./<name>/ in the current directory. The
--dir flag above overrides this to place skills in .claude/skills/, which
is the standard Claude Code skill location.
Without aigent CLI
If aigent is not available, generate the SKILL.md directly.
Name rules
- Lowercase letters, numbers, and hyphens only
- Maximum 64 characters
- Prefer gerund form: "processing-pdfs", "analyzing-data"
- No reserved words: "anthropic", "claude"
- No XML tags
- Must match directory name
Description rules
- Non-empty, maximum 1024 characters
- Third person: "Processes PDFs..." not "I process PDFs..."
- Include what the skill does AND when to use it
- No XML tags
Body guidelines
- Keep under 500 lines
- Be concise — only add context Claude doesn't already have
- Use ## headings for sections
- Link to additional files for large content
Output
Write the SKILL.md to .claude/skills/<name>/SKILL.md with:
---
name: <kebab-case-name>
description: <what-it-does-and-when-to-use-it>
---
# <Title>
## Quick start
[Concise instructions]
## Usage
[Detailed usage]
